Chlorine in PDB 2hc1: Engineered Catalytic Domain of Protein Tyrosine Phosphatase Hptpbeta.

Enzymatic activity of Engineered Catalytic Domain of Protein Tyrosine Phosphatase Hptpbeta.

All present enzymatic activity of Engineered Catalytic Domain of Protein Tyrosine Phosphatase Hptpbeta.:
3.1.3.48;

Protein crystallography data

The structure of Engineered Catalytic Domain of Protein Tyrosine Phosphatase Hptpbeta., PDB code: 2hc1 was solved by A.G.Evdokimov, M.Pokross, R.Walter, M.Mekel,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 33.88 / 1.30
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 39.060, 70.714, 118.455, 90.00, 90.00, 90.00
R / Rfree (%) 13.4 / 17.9
